Continuous Flow α-Trifluoromethylation of Ketones by Metal-Free Visible Light Photoredox Catalysis

Abstract

In a continuous-flow, two-step procedure for the preparation of α-CF3-substituted carbonyl compounds, carbonyl substrates were converted in situ into the corresponding silyl enol ethers, mixed with a CF3 radical source, and then irradiated with visible light using transparent tubing and a household compact fluorescent lamp. The continuous protocol uses Eosin Y as an inexpensive photoredox catalyst and requires only 20 min for both steps.
